In a Friday letter on Biden’s condition, O’Connor made clear that a number of the president’s listed medications were being withheld while he takes Paxlovid for COVID.
“His apixaban (ELIQUIS) and rosuvastatin (Crestor) are being held during PAXLOVID treatment and for several days after his last dose,” the doctor wrote. “During this time, it is reasonable to add low dose aspiring as an alternative type of blood thinner.”
